Only the Limit bots adapt to your play. The NL bots can't adapt.

I have made a few adjustments to make Poker Pro like the games I play in.

<ul type="square"> [img]/images/graemlins/club.gif[/img]I adjust the setting for the tournament--the starting stacks, what the blinds begin at, how often they go up, to reflect my home game.
[img]/images/graemlins/heart.gif[/img]I adjust individual bots at my table so they play more like the players I play against.
[img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img]I will swap bots assigned to a given tournament with bots whose game I find challenging.
[img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img]When I check out my stats, I pay more attention to how I do against the bots who win against me.[/list]
It is useful, even if it's not as difficult as playing against live players. The more I play, the more I use the player statistics analysis. Regardless of how you do against bots, it can tell you your tendencies--such which hands you are aggressive/passive with in which positions.
